Perc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in WB: Africa Eastern and Southern
WB: Africa Eastern and Southern: Perc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education was 50.6% in 2023. ▼ Falling
Perc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in WB: Africa Eastern and Southern, 1997–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
The most recent figure for perc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in WB: Africa Eastern and Southern is 50.6%, measured in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.8% on the previous year and down 1.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in WB: Africa Eastern and Southern peaked at 103.0% in 1997 and was at its lowest, 44.2%, in 2012.
WB: Africa Eastern and Southern ranks 24th of 214 groups on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 27 years of available data.
